This year virtually certain' to be hottest on record, finds EU space programme
Briefly

The report found 2024 is likely to be the first year more than 1.5C hotter than before the Industrial Revolution, a level of warming that has alarmed scientists.
World leaders promised to stop the planet from heating 1.5C by the end of the century but are on track to heat it by roughly double that.
This inevitably pushes our ability to respond to extreme events and adapt to a warmer world to the absolute limit, said Carlo Buontempo, the director of Copernicus.
Scientists say a single year above the threshold does not mean they have missed the target, but warn that it will force more people and ecosystems to the brink of survival.
